Transaction d24906514b8d844e1615eb3e2c6c4db54fab520b8dbb5cba113e44c76449ba49

72 Input
2 Outputs
  • d24906514b8d844e1615eb3e2c6c4db54fab520b8dbb5cba113e44c76449ba49:0
  • value  950043836
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• d24906514b8d844e1615eb3e2c6c4db54fab520b8dbb5cba113e44c76449ba49:1
  • value  896991
    address  3DjZuDu6DnagmiPeVB5T48LdG9FhKvoE2k